Exploring effective professional networking resources can significantly boost one’s career advancement.

Q1: What constitutes a ‘professional networking resource’?
  • A professional networking resource connects individuals with professionals in their field, facilitating the exchange of information, opportunities, and contacts.
  • These resources can include digital platforms, organizations, events, and more.
Q2: Can you name some popular digital platforms for professional networking?
  • LinkedIn: Primarily focuses on professional networking and career development.
  • Twitter: Useful for following industry leaders and participating in topical conversations.
  • Facebook: Offers numerous professional groups and networking opportunities.
Q3: Are professional organizations and associations worth joining?
  • Yes, they provide specialized networking opportunities, resources, and industry insights pertinent to specific professions.
  • Example: American Marketing Association (AMA),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(IEEE).

Q4: What are the key benefits of attending industry conferences and seminars?
  • Direct engagement with leaders and innovators in the field.
  • Opportunity to engage in workshops and talks that can enhance skills and knowledge.
  • Networking opportunities with peers and potential employers.

Q5: How important is it to have a personal brand when networking?
  • Creating a personal brand is crucial; it distinguishes one in a crowded market.
  • It involves maintaining a professional online presence, regular engagement with content pertinent to one’s field, and portraying a consistent image across various platforms.

Q6: How could one measure the success of their networking efforts?
  • Increased connections relevant to career growth.
  • Job offers or career advancement opportunities that arise as direct results from networking.
  • Engagement metrics such as likes, shares, and comments on professional platforms like LinkedIn.

In summary, the best professional networking resources blend online platforms, active participation in relevant organizations, and consistent personal branding efforts. By strategically engaging with these resources, professionals can significantly enhance their career trajectories.

I’ve been hitting the network scene hard these past few years, especially after realizing how important they are for getting ahead. For starters, LinkedIn is like your bread and butter, dude. I keep my profile slick and join groups that are in my field. I don’t just add people randomly; I connect after webinars, workshops, or group discussions. Always add a personal note on why you want to connect, believe me, makes a big difference. Then there are these industry events, man, if you can get into one, go! You meet folks who are usually big fishes, and it’s not just about handing out business cards but really about making meaningful connections. Chit-chat, exchange ideas, or even share a meal, it’s old school but works every time.

Overview of Professional Networking Resources

Professional networking is a key component to career advancement in virtually any field. Multiple resources exist to facilitate these connections, each tailored to specific professional needs and environments.

LinkedIn

As the world’s largest professional network, LinkedIn is invaluable. It allows professionals to connect, share, and learn through a digital platform. Profiles serve as digital resumes, and the platform offers numerous tools for career development, including job postings, insights into companies, and the ability to publish or share professional content.

Industry Conferences and Seminars

Attending industry-specific conferences and seminars is a powerful way to network. These events provide a platform for exchanging ideas, learning about the latest trends, and connecting with peers. Often, these gatherings also offer workshops or panels led by industry leaders, which can provide both learning and direct connection opportunities.

Professional Associations

Joining professional associations can also offer significant networking opportunities. Most sectors have associations that host events, provide mentoring programs, and encourage professional growth through resources like journals and newsletters.
